The Polyform G-2 Twin Eye Fender 4.5" x 15.5" in white is a marine-grade protective barrier designed for boat owners and dock operators who demand durability without premium pricing. This utility fender serves as a critical collision buffer between your vessel and pilings, other boats, or dock structures, absorbing impact energy to prevent hull damage during mooring and tight-space navigation. Its compact 4.5-inch diameter profile makes it ideal for smaller craft, sailboats, and tender vessels where space efficiency matters.
Built by Polyform U.S., this fender incorporates reinforced ribs throughout its polyurethane construction, enhancing structural integrity and resistance to UV degradation and salt water exposure. The twin-eye design—featuring two integrated attachment points—allows secure fastening via rope or chain at top and bottom positions, preventing rotation and ensuring the fender remains properly oriented during use. The inflation valve system enables field adjustment of firmness, allowing operators to customize dampening response based on vessel weight and impact frequency. At just 1.2 pounds, the fender's lightweight construction minimizes deck clutter while maintaining the strength necessary for repeated dock contact.
This fender suits freshwater and saltwater environments, making it equally at home on inland lakes and coastal moorings. Installation is straightforward—secure the top and bottom eye rings to your vessel's rail or stanchion using quality marine-grade line, then inflate to the recommended firmness using a standard air pump. The white finish provides excellent visibility in poor light and against dark hulls, improving safety during dawn and dusk operations.
